Cross of Glory Church will host a free Fall Fest on Saturday, September 20, from 12 p.m. to 4 p.m. The event is open to Fairmont families and will take place at the church. Activities planned include live music, games, food, face painting, and other family-friendly attractions.

Fairmont School District 89 serves Will County and includes Fairmont School within its boundaries (https://www.illinoisreportcard.com/). According to the Illinois State Board of Education, the district's student body is made up of approximately 12.7 percent White students, 38.5 percent Black students, 46 percent Hispanic students, and 0.3 percent Asian students (https://www.illinoisreportcard.com/).

The district employs a total of 30 teachers with an average salary of $47,800 before pension contributions; about 80.3 percent are women and 19.7 percent are men (https://www.illinoisreportcard.com/). None of these teachers have recorded more than ten absences in a school year.

In the year 2020, Fairmont School District 89 reported spending $21,521 per student for a total expenditure of $6,929,762 (https://www.illinoisreportcard.com/).
